What Does OPW Stand For?
OPW stands for Orthogonalized Plane Wave
OPW, or Orthogonalized Plane Wave, refers to a computational method used in quantum mechanics and solid-state physics to describe electronic states in materials. This technique involves the use of plane wave functions that are orthogonalized to ensure accurate representation of wavefunctions in periodic systems. OPW is particularly useful in band structure calculations and helps in the efficient modeling of electrons in crystalline solids by providing a basis set that can effectively capture the behavior of electrons while minimizing computational complexity.
